Origin of Six Sigma Manufacturing

Six Sigma is a manufacturing process control strategy which first implemented by Motorola.

Six sigma being common used by any sectors of industry nowadays, especially those precision product manufacturing.

Six Sigma manufacturing implemented to control the process or stabilize the process. Then, seeks to improve the quality of process outputs.

To stable or improve the process, six sigma manufacturing tools need to be used to achieve the target.

Six sigma, distribution and possibility 
  • There are two method to describe the process.
  • Traditional method using the maximum, minimum and range value to describe the process. Process manufacturing do not know when the process will excess the maximum or minimum (error or defect). Therefore, the range, maximum and minimum value do not give idea on the process.
  • So, process manufacturing expert develop measurement scale upon which improvement / performance can be gauged which is possibility. And six sigma is the methodology that provides standardized problem-solving tools improvement.
  • Distribution and possibility
  • What is process sigma about?
  • Process sigma is a possibility, a possibility that error/defect occur in the manufacturing process.
  • Necessary to achieve six sigma?
  • It depends on the customer requirement. The specification provided by customer directly affect the process sigma.
  • How many sigma are required in the manufacturing process?
  • It depends on the customer requirement. Six sigma company will provide the requirement on either Cpk or PPM to the supplier.
